no its not if its le last 3 min of the shine time. unless they changed the rule again. they made that change a cpoouple years ago that you can squall the last 3 min of shine time even if a nother dog is out working.
rule 17 gen onfo. handler cannot squal for the first 7 min of shine time unless all dogs are treed/if all dogs are not treed than handler can squal last threee min. of shine time.
